ABOUT THE OPPORTUNITY

The Quality Assistant role focuses on maintaining and developing systems and procedures, in conjunction with the QHSE Manager, to ensure compliance with all relevant health and safety legislation. You will serve as a resource for management, providing advice on best practices related to health and safety.

Key activities:

  • Collaborate with the QHSE Manager to be a UKAS point of contact at Intertek Leigh for compliance and accreditation requirements, overseeing UKAS audits, improvement actions, and non-compliance resolutions.
  • Support the Quality Systems team at Intertek Leigh and work closely with laboratory staff, maintaining good relationships.
  • Assist in maintaining and updating the Quality Management Systems, communicating changes to relevant staff.
  • Act as an internal quality auditor, and nominate additional auditors if needed.
  • Support calibration and servicing of laboratory equipment.
  • Develop and maintain a register of current and upcoming health and safety legislation and interpret standards.
  • Create training materials and audit programs for health, safety, and quality management systems, identifying staff training needs.
  • Ensure a Health and Safety Policy is in place, report incidents, lead safety inspections, and promote safe practices.
  • Investigate non-conformances, customer complaints, and root causes, ensuring corrective actions are implemented.
  • Maintain proficiency test results and investigate incidents and near misses.
  • Hold safety meetings with site management, safety representatives, and first aiders.
  • Ensure risk assessments are documented and accessible.
  • Assist in producing operational budgets related to QHSE requirements.
